英文摘要Effect of amphiphilic molecules upon the chromatic transitions of polymerized 10, 1 2-pentacosadiynoic acid (PCDA) vesicles in aqueous solutions was reported. The colorimetric response of polymerized PCDA vesicles for I -pentanol is higher than that for ethanol due to more hydrophobic property of I-pentanol. The colorimetric response of polymerized PCDA vesicles for sodium dodecyl sulfate (SDS) and Triton X-100 is lower than that for cetyltrimethylammonium bromide (CTAB). The strong ability of CTAB to induce chromatic transition of the vesicles is related to the positively charged headgroups of CTAB, which favors approach of CTAB to the negatively charged carboxylate groups at the vesicle surface. The insertion of alkyl chain of CTAB into the hydrophobic domain perturbs the conformation of the conjugated polymer backbone and induces color change of polydiacetylene vesicles. For a series of alkylamine hydrochloric salts, the longer the alkyl chain, the stronger the ability of alkylamine to induce chromatic transition of polydiacetylene vesicles.
